Using PC headphone/mic with telephone socket

Our office recently migrated to Cisco 7491 VOIP phones. Our old phones let us use the headset/microphone sets you buy for a computer as a headset. It had a socket for the standard micro (?) plug. These new phones have a standard phone socket (I guess RJ-11?) and the only option we've found so far are the Plantronics headsets. At $100 each the company is not going to be purchasing them for everyone. I'm wondering if anyone knows of an adapter that will let you plug a headset with a micro plug into an RJ-11 socket and get both voice and audio enabled.
